html{font-size:100%;scroll-behavior:smooth}*,*::before,*::after{padding:0;margin:0;box-sizing:border-box}.page-width{max-width:1320px;margin:0 auto}.btn{background-color:var(--navy-color);display:inline-block;font-weight:700;align-items:center;color:var(--navy-color);border:.0625rem solid var(--navy-color);cursor:pointer;font-size:.875rem;padding:.625rem 1rem}.header__desc{font-size:1rem;line-height:1.25;font-weight:500;color:var(--light-navy-color);text-align:justify;margin-bottom:2rem}.header__desc.small{font-size:1rem}.showcase__logo-desc{font-size:1.125rem;font-weight:500;margin-bottom:1.5rem}.showcase__logo{display:grid;grid-template-columns:repeat(5,1fr);gap:2rem}.showcase__logo a{display:flex;align-items:center;padding:1.5rem;background:var(--white-color);border-radius:.5rem;text-align:center}.showcase__logo a img{max-height:6rem;margin:0 auto}.contact__grid-detail{position:relative;z-index:100;color:var(--light-navy-color)}.contact__grid-detail h2{font-size:2.25rem;line-height:1.2;margin-bottom:.75rem}.contact__grid-detail .desc{font-size:1.5rem;line-height:1.2}.contact__grid-cards{display:grid;grid-template-columns:1fr 2fr;gap:8.5rem;margin-top:2.5rem;position:relative;z-index:5}.stelling__grid-button{padding:1.375rem 1.5rem;font-weight:700;border:1px solid;border-radius:.5rem;color:var(--light-navy-color);background:var(--white-color);cursor:pointer}.stelling__grid-button:not(:last-child){margin-bottom:1.25rem}.contact__grid-input{position:relative;padding:7.5rem 4.25rem 2.375rem;background:var(--white-color);border:1px solid var(--aqua-marine);text-align:right}.contact__grid-input textarea{font-family:"Mulish";font-size:1.25rem;width:100%;border:1px solid var(--light-blue-color);border-radius:1.25rem;padding:2rem;color:var(--aqua-marine);resize:none;margin-bottom:1.5rem;text-align:left}.contact__grid-input textarea::placeholder{color:var(--light-blue-color)}.contact__grid-input a{margin-left:auto}.chat_bot-icon{position:absolute;top:-7.5rem;left:50%;width:15rem;height:15rem;object-fit:contain;transform:translateX(-50%)}.chat_bot-icon-partij{position:absolute;top:.9rem;left:50%;max-height:4rem;object-fit:contain;transform:translateX(-50%)}.showcase__illustration{position:absolute;left:0;bottom:0;right:0;width:60%;height:520px;object-fit:cover;z-index:0;object-position:top center}.parties__details{margin-block:5rem}.parties__details .page-width{display:grid;grid-template-columns:repeat(3,1fr);column-gap:6.25rem;row-gap:4rem}.parties__detail{font-size:3.75rem;line-height:1.2;font-weight:700;color:var(--navy-color)}.parties__detail-card{position:relative;background:var(--white-color);box-shadow:3px 3px 16px 4px rgba(0,0,0,.15);padding:2rem 2rem 5.5rem;border-radius:1rem}.parties__card-icon{display:flex;align-items:center;justify-content:space-between;gap:3rem;margin-bottom:1rem}.parties__card-icon h2{font-size:1.5rem;line-height:1.2;font-weight:600;color:#23242a}.parties__card-icon img{width:5rem;height:5rem;object-fit:contain}.parties__detail-content{font-size:.95rem;line-height:1.3;color:#23242a}.parties__detail-content a{display:block;margin-block:.75rem;color:var(--light-navy-color)}.parties__detail-content-link{position:absolute;width:100%;height:4.375rem;display:flex;align-items:center;justify-content:flex-start;left:0;bottom:0;background:var(--light-navy-color);color:var(--light-blue-color);font-size:1.125rem;padding-inline:2rem;z-index:10;border-bottom-left-radius:1rem;border-bottom-right-radius:1rem}.parties__detail-content-link:hover{color:#fff}.footer{padding-block:4.375rem 1rem;background:#00095c}.footer__title{font-size:3.75rem;line-height:1.2;color:var(--white-color);margin-bottom:2rem}.footer__cards{display:grid;grid-template-columns:repeat(1,1fr);gap:3.125rem}.footer__card{padding:3rem 1.5rem;background:transparent;border-radius:.9375rem;color:var(--white-color)}.footer__card-light{background:#ccf4ff;color:#00244d}.footer__card h2{font-size:2.25rem;font-weight:500;margin-bottom:1.25rem}.footer__card h2.opacity__0{opacity:0}.footer__card p{line-height:1.3;font-weight:300}.footer__card a{display:block;font-weight:600;margin-top:1.25rem;font-style:italic}.sub__footer{display:flex;align-items:center;justify-content:space-between;color:#ccf4ff;padding-top:1rem;border-top:1px solid #000;margin-top:4.0625rem;font-style:italic}@media(max-width:1440px){.page-width{max-width:75rem}.header__image{min-width:25rem;max-width:25rem}.header .page-width{gap:9rem}.header__title{font-size:3.125rem}.parties__detail{font-size:3.125rem}.parties__details .page-width{gap:4rem}.parties__card-icon{gap:2rem}.parties__card-icon h2{width:60%}}@media(max-width:1200px){.page-width{max-width:46rem}.header{margin-block:3.5rem}.header .page-width{gap:4rem}.header__image{min-width:15rem;max-width:15rem}.header__title{font-size:1.575rem;margin-bottom:.625rem;line-height:1.2}.header__desc{font-size:.875rem;margin-bottom:.875rem}.btn{font-size:.875rem;padding:.625rem 1rem}.showcase__logo-desc{font-size:1rem;margin-bottom:2rem}.showcase__logo{grid-template-columns:repeat(3,1fr)}.showcase__logo a{padding:1.25rem}.showcase__logo a img{max-height:4rem}.contact__grid-cards{grid-template-columns:repeat(1,1fr)}.contact__grid-detail h2{font-size:1.75rem;margin-bottom:0}.contact__grid-detail .desc{font-size:1.25rem}.chat_bot-icon{width:10rem;height:10rem;top:-5rem}.contact__grid-input{padding:6rem 2.5rem 2.5rem}.contact__grid-input{text-align:center}.contact__grid-input textarea{display:inline;width:48%;float:right;min-height:20rem;padding:1.375rem}.contact__grid-input textarea:first-of-type{margin-left:1.375rem}.showcase__illustration{width:100%;height:50%}.parties__details{margin-block:1.5rem 4rem}.parties__details .page-width{display:flex;flex-wrap:wrap;column-gap:2rem;row-gap:3rem}.parties__detail{flex:100%;text-align:center}.parties__detail-card{width:calc(50% - 32px/2)}.parties__detail-card{border-radius:.3125rem}.parties__detail-content-link{border-bottom-left-radius:.3125rem;border-bottom-right-radius:.3125rem}.footer__cards{grid-template-columns:repeat(1,1fr)}.footer__title{font-size:3.125rem;margin-bottom:1.5rem}.sub__footer{margin-top:.625rem;border-color:#ccf4ff}}@media(max-width:750px){.page-width{max-width:90%}.header .page-width{flex-flow:column}.header{margin-block:2rem}.header .page-width{gap:.625rem}.header__image{min-width:11.25rem;max-width:11.25rem}.header__content{text-align:center}.showcase__logo{grid-template-columns:repeat(1,1fr)}.showcase__logo a{width:11.25rem;margin-inline:auto;height:6.25rem}.contact__grid-detail h2,.contact__grid-detail .desc,.contact__grid-card{display:none}.contact__grid-input{padding:5.5rem 1.25rem 1.25rem}.contact__grid-input textarea{margin-left:0;width:100%;float:none}.contact__grid-input textarea:first-of-type{margin-left:0}.contact__grid-input textarea{min-height:5.25rem}.parties__detail-card{width:100%}.parties__detail{font-size:1.5rem;text-align:left}.parties__detail-content-link{height:3.4375rem;font-size:1rem}.footer{padding-block:3rem 1rem}.footer__title{font-size:2.25rem}.footer__card{padding:2rem 1.5rem}.footer__card:nth-child(2){padding-block:1rem}.footer__card h2.opacity__0{display:none}.nav .nav__logo{max-width:6rem}}#query{color:var(--navy-color) !important;font-size:1rem;padding:10px}#message{font-family:"Mulish" !important;color:var(--navy-color) !important;overflow:auto;height:500px;font-size:1rem;width:100%;border:1px solid var(--light-blue-color);border-radius:1.25rem;padding:2rem;color:var(--aqua-marine);margin-bottom:1.5rem;text-align:left;white-space:pre-wrap;word-wrap:break-word}.contact__grid-input button{background-color:#fff}@keyframes rotate{from{transform:rotate(0deg)}to{transform:rotate(360deg)}}.rotating{animation:rotate 2s linear infinite}.overlay{position:fixed;top:0;left:0;width:100vw;height:100vh;background:rgba(0,0,0,.5);display:none;justify-content:center;align-items:center;z-index:1000}.hidden{display:none}.error{color:#f00;font-style:italic}.typing-dots{display:inline-block;text-align:left;white-space:nowrap;overflow:hidden}.dot{display:inline-block;width:10px;height:10px;background-color:#fff;margin-right:4px;animation:typing-dot 1s linear infinite}@keyframes typing-dot{0%,25%{opacity:0;transform:translateX(-20px)}50%{opacity:1;transform:translateX(0)}75%,100%{opacity:0;transform:translateX(20px)}}.inactive-message-area{padding-top:100px !important;text-align:center !important;border:none !important;font-size:1.5rem !important}.bekijk-prog-link{display:inline !important}.bekijk-prog-link.angles-right{height:9px !important}.too-many-requests{padding-top:50px;text-align:center;font-size:1.25rem;font-family:var(--primary-fonts);background-color:var(--white-color);color:#f08080;font-weight:bold}.spacer{margin-right:20px}.u-heeft-gekozen-voor{text-align:center;font-size:smaller}.zetel-count{background-color:rgba(255,255,255,.5);position:relative;top:-30px;padding:5px;font-weight:bold;color:#fff;font-size:1.8rem;background-color:#f00;padding:10px;border-radius:25px;min-width:50px}.zetel-count.VVD{left:30px}@media(max-width:750px){.zetel-count{background-color:rgba(255,255,255,.5);position:relative;top:-30px;padding:5px;font-weight:bold;color:#fff;font-size:1rem;background-color:#f00;padding:5px;border-radius:20px;min-width:30px}.zetel-count.VVD{left:35px}.zetel-count.BBB{left:25px}}